Georgia JaggerFresh-faced Georgia Jagger is proud of her gapped-tooth smile.

The 17-year-old model, daughter of Rolling Stones legend Sir Mick Jagger and supermodel Jerry Hall, doesn’t want to undergo dental procedures to have her teeth corrected as she thinks it gives her a unique look.

“I think my gap adds character. A while ago on the street, a guy yelled, ‘You could stick a gold through your front teeth.’ Which meant I could put a £1 coin between them. But you can’t, I’ve tried. 50 pence coins and two pence coins, yes. But not a pound.”

Georgia also revealed her famous father used to tell her off for wearing wearing make-up before she became a teenager. The blonde star, who is the face of Hudson Jeans and Rimmel London, said, ” We have a snap of my dad wearing blue eye shadow. which I would always make fun of. When I was about 12 and first started wearing lipstick, my dad would ask ‘Are you wearing make-up?’ I would say back, ‘You’re wearing more make-up there than I am!’”
